There is a reason why the new thriller series, "Clickbait," has received so much popularity since its release and landed on Netflix's top 10 list.
"Clickbait" is a limited eight-episode series about a perfect family man, Nick Brewer, kidnapped and held hostage in a viral video posted online. As his family races to find him, devastating secrets begin to unravel about who Nick indeed was.
In every episode, new secrets are revealed, along with potential suspects. There are so many plot twists and cliffhangers that I honestly started to get confused. I didn't know what to expect or even what to believe anymore because every time I made a guess, something else would happen.
It reminds me of another show called "Black Mirror" as it was not only a thriller but had a more profound message behind it about our society. It touched on the dangers of online dating, internet addiction, and vigilante culture.
So if you're looking for a show that's unpredictable and well worth the click, this is it.
